What to Know About the Air Jordan 6 Infrared "Salesman" Release
The Air Jordan 6 Infrared "Salesman" is releasing for the first time in spring 2026, inspired by an unreleased sample from 1999. This shoe represents a unique moment in sneaker history, where a sample that was never meant for public consumption is now becoming available to everyone. The "Salesman" colorway includes both a hangtag and packaging that resemble how footwear samples arrive for review before they are produced, giving buyers an authentic experience of what it's like to receive a sample pair.

Why This Shoe Matters
The Air Jordan 6 "Reverse Infrared" isn't just another retro—it's a sneaker rooted in a mistake, a sample, and a piece of Jordan history that collectors have talked about for decades. The original Air Jordan 6 dropped in 1991 and was Michael Jordan's shoe during his first NBA championship. The Infrared colorway became iconic, but this reverse version from 1999 represents something entirely different—a moment when Jordan Brand was experimenting with designs that never made it to production.
The Air Jordan 6 Reverse Infrared sample pair from 1999 will officially release for the first time as a retro in 2026. This is unprecedented in sneaker history. Typically, samples that don't make it to production stay that way, but Nike has recognized the cultural significance of this particular sample and is giving it the full retro treatment.

The Cultural Impact
This release represents a shift in how Jordan Brand views its archive and unreleased samples. For years, these samples were considered off-limits, but the success of releases like the Shattered Backboard and other sample-inspired colorways has shown that there's a huge market for these historical pieces. The Air Jordan 6 Reverse Infrared is perhaps the most significant sample release yet, as it's based on a shoe that was never meant to exist in the first place.
